首页--工业技术论文--自动化技术、计算机技术论文--计算技术、计算机技术论文--计算机软件论文--程序设计、软件工程论文--程序设计论文

基于关系数据库的程序逆向分析架构研究

摘要第1-9页
ABSTRACT第9-11页
第一章 前言第11-18页
   ·研究背景第11页
   ·研究意义第11-12页
   ·国内外研究现状第12-16页
   ·研究的主要内容第16-17页
   ·论文结构第17页
   ·小结第17-18页
第二章 逆向工程概述第18-31页
   ·逆向工程的定义及相关概念第18-20页
   ·逆向工程的规范活动第20-22页
   ·逆向工程中的程序理解第22-27页
     ·程序理解的定义第22-23页
     ·程序理解的任务第23-24页
     ·程序理解的困难第24页
     ·程序理解方法的分类第24-27页
   ·逆向工程辅助工具的研究第27-29页
     ·开发逆向工程辅助工具的原则第27-28页
     ·开发自动化的逆向工程工具的困难第28页
     ·未来软件逆向工程辅助工具开发的方向第28-29页
   ·小结第29-31页
第三章 基于关系数据库的程序逆向分析架构的设计第31-41页
   ·架构的设计原理第31页
   ·架构的设计原则第31页
   ·架构的工作流程第31-32页
   ·实体描述第32-33页
   ·实体概念关联扩展文法第33页
   ·语义关联描述第33-34页
   ·逆向分析器第34-39页
     ·词法分析的功能第34-35页
     ·词法分析的输出第35-36页
     ·词法分析程序第36-37页
     ·语法分析的任务第37页
     ·语法分析器的自动生成第37-39页
   ·程序信息库第39-40页
   ·扩展的源程序第40页
   ·数据库应用程序第40页
   ·小结第40-41页
第四章 C 语言程序逆向分析研究第41-54页
   ·C 语言程序逆向分析的目标第41页
   ·C 语言程序逆向分析的步骤第41-49页
     ·C 语言实体描述第41-42页
     ·C 语言实体概念关联及文法扩展第42-43页
     ·语义关联描述第43页
     ·C 语言词法分析器的构造第43-44页
     ·C 语言语法分析器的构造第44-45页
     ·程序信息库的设计第45-48页
     ·信息库的简单应用第48-49页
   ·数据库应用程序第49页
   ·程序逆向分析示例第49-53页
   ·小结第53-54页
结束语第54-56页
参考文献第56-59页
致谢第59-60页
附录A 攻读学位期间发表论文第60-61页
附录B C 语言词法LEX 程序第61-66页
附录C C 语言语法YACC 程序第66-72页
详细摘要第72-76页

论文共76页,点击 下载论文
上一篇:医患会话特征研究
下一篇:张荫桓的外交思想与实践